So I've decided to add them to the 1.7.4 pack, this will be the last release of the 1.7.4 pack.
John Smith Legacy
-{1.2.9}- 18th February 2014 - 1.7.4
JimStoneCraft
<ADDED>
[JohnCooldude876] textures/entity/iron_golem.png
[JimStoneCraft] mcpatcher/colormap/lavadrop.png
mcpatcher/colormap/myceliumparticle.png
mcpatcher/colormap/redstone.png
mcpatcher/colormap/xporb.png
mcpatcher/colormap/melonstem.png
mcpatcher/colormap/pumpkinstem.png
mcpatcher/line/fishingline.png
mcpatcher/line/fishingline.properties
mcpatcher/line/lead.png
mcpatcher/line/lead.properties
mcpatcher/mob/skeleton/skeleton2 - 15.png
mcpatcher/mob/skeleton/wither_skeleton2 - 15.png
New Iron Golem.
Custom colours for Melon and Pumpkin stems, dripping lava, Mycelium particle effect, Redstone and XP Orb.
Lead and Fishing Line textures.
Redone the Skeleton and Wither Skeleton CTM textures to add some more variety, there are now sixteen versions of each Skeleton.
JimStoneCraft
<UPDATED>
[JimStoneCraft] textures/blocks/sapling_jungle.png
textures/gui/container/beacon.png
textures/entity/skeleton/skeleton.png
textures/entity/skeleton/wither_skeleton.png
Cleaned up the Jungle Sapling and Beacon button textures.
Redone the Skeleton and Wither Skeleton textures to match the new CTM files.
Moved all the helper files into it's own directory, this is more for texture authors than end users.
Added some more custom colours for the XP Bar, Ender Dragon and sign text.
Spawner Egg Colour added to the color.properties, also reorganised the file into an easier reading layout.

John Smith Legacy
-{1.2.10}- 19th February 2014 - 1.7.4
JimStoneCraft
<UPDATED>
[JimStoneCraft] textures/gui/container/brewing_stand.png
textures/gui/container/crafting_table.png
textures/gui/container/furnace.png
textures/gui/container/inventory.png
textures/gui/container/villager.png
textures/items/empty_armor_slot_boots.png
textures/items/empty_armor_slot_chestplate.png
textures/items/empty_armor_slot_helmet.png
textures/items/empty_armor_slot_leggings.png
textures/items/leather_boots.png
textures/items/leather_boots_overlay.png
textures/items/leather_chestplate.png
textures/items/leather_chestplate_overlay.png
textures/items/leather_helmet.png
textures/items/leather_helmet_overlay.png
textures/items/leather_leggings.png
textures/items/leather_leggings_overlay.png
Sorted out an alignment issue with the Furnace, Brewing Stand and villager GUI.
Also cleaned up and made the GUI screens more consistent.
Cleaned up positioning and some dirty pixels on the Armour icons, also adjusted the leather armour to suit the icon positions.
